Redefining the Purpose of Saving



For decades, conventional economic suggestions has actually leaned greatly on the principles of thriftiness, postponed satisfaction, and hostile saving. From cutting out early morning coffee to abandoning vacations, the message has been loud and clear: conserve now, take pleasure in later on. Yet as societal worths shift and individuals reassess what financial wellness actually indicates, a softer, a lot more conscious method to money is obtaining grip. This is the essence of soft conserving-- an emerging way of thinking that concentrates much less on stockpiling cash and more on lining up financial choices with a significant, cheerful life.



Soft conserving doesn't mean abandoning duty. It's not concerning ignoring your future or investing recklessly. Rather, it's concerning balance. It's concerning acknowledging that life is happening now, and your cash needs to support your joy, not simply your retirement account.



The Emotional Side of Money



Cash is typically viewed as a numbers video game, but the way we earn, invest, and save is deeply psychological. From youth experiences to societal pressures, our monetary habits are formed by more than reasoning. Hostile conserving methods, while effective theoretically, can occasionally fuel anxiousness, sense of guilt, and a consistent fear of "not having sufficient."



Soft saving invites us to consider exactly how we really feel concerning our economic selections. Are you avoiding dinner with friends since you're trying to adhere to a rigid savings plan? Are you delaying that journey you've dreamed concerning for many years because it doesn't appear "liable?" Soft conserving obstacles these narratives by asking: what's the emotional price of severe saving?



Why Millennials and Gen Z Are Shifting Gears



The more recent generations aren't always making extra, however they are reimagining what riches appears like. After seeing economic recessions, real estate crises, and currently navigating post-pandemic truths, younger people are examining the knowledge of postponing pleasure for a later date that isn't assured.



They're selecting experiences over belongings. They're focusing on mental health, adaptable work, and everyday pleasures. And they're doing it while still preserving a feeling of economic obligation-- simply on their own terms. This shift has prompted more people to reassess what they really desire from their economic trip: peace of mind, not excellence.

Letting Go of the "All or Nothing" Mindset



One of the greatest difficulties in individual finance is the propensity to think in extremes. You're either saving every dime or you're stopping working. You're either paying off all financial debt or you're behind. Soft saving presents nuance. It claims you can conserve and invest. You can plan for the future and live in today.



For example, lots of people feel overwhelmed when picking between traveling and paying for a car loan. However what if you budgeted modestly for both? By including delight, you might actually feel even more motivated and encouraged to remain on track with your financial goals.

Soft Saving Is Still Smart Saving



Skeptics may argue that soft saving is just a rebranding of investing much more openly. But that's not the situation. It's a calculated, psychological, and deeply human strategy to managing cash in a manner that honors your existing and your future. It teaches you to build a padding without smothering your pleasure. It aids you see it here create space in your life to thrive, not just endure.



This doesn't suggest you'll never require to be disciplined or make sacrifices. It just implies that when you do, you'll understand why. Every buck saved will certainly have a purpose, and every buck invested will certainly feel aligned with what you value a lot of.



Financial health isn't a finish line. It's a continual procedure of understanding, readjusting, and expanding. And as you check out just how to make the most of your sources, soft saving supplies a revitalizing pointer: your cash is a device, not an examination.
